The UK Government is heavily promoting and supporting the use of renewable heating in place of fossil fuels such as heat pump systems through a mix of stimulus including incentives. These incentives aim to help reducing the UK greenhouse gas emissions by meeting its renewable energy targets. However, the recent changes to the EU F-Gas regulations may have significant impact on the growth of the heat pump technology, as some of the HFCs mostly used in heat pumps have been proposed to be phased-out. This report provides a critical review of refrigerants currently available today and in the future for heat pumps and comments on their suitability and effectiveness in reducing carbon emissions. The refrigerant options for air-to-water heat pumps are analysed comparing the performance from whole life carbon, operating cost, safety and practical perspectives in typical domestic application.
